Description

We will travel to Colusa NWR to photograph waterfowl from the viewing platform. This is where Jeff has spent many hours capturing fantastic photos of the Central Valley’s waterfowl, especially the Snow and Ross’s Geese, Greater White-fronted Goose, Northern Pintail, wigeon, and many other options as well. Be prepared for the weather and bring your big lenses with a tripod. 300mm and longer is best for this field trip. Jeff will share tips on site and answer any and all questions as the birds abound and the sun sets. There will be a chance to lie in the dirt. All ages 15 and older are welcome.

Field Trip Leader

Jeffrey Rich, Wildlife Photonaturalist

Jeffrey Rich graduated from Humboldt State University in 1983 with a BS in Wildlife biology, in 1985 with a BS in Biology, and a life science teaching credential in 1986. In 2012 Jeff completed his master’s degree in science teaching and education at the University of Texas. Jeff has been teaching science and photography, while photographing nature, professionally since 1987.
